Remco Evenepoel says only chance to win La Fleche Wallonne 2025 is to: "Wear down the really explosive guys as much as possible... The Mur de Huy doesn’t suit me"

Remco Evenepoel has been absolutely electric since making a winning return to racing recently at Brabantse Pijl. Following a podium at the Amstel Gold Race, the Soudal - Quick-Step leader now has eyes firmly focused La Fleche Wallonne, although he admits the race isn't best suited to him.
In his one and only previous appearance at La Fleche Wallonne back in 2022, Evenepoel finished 43rd back in 2022. It's likely the Olympic champion will be much closer to the fight for victory this time around, but can the Belgian add another big win to his palmares? “It’s going to be tough to get away solo on this course,” Evenepoel says of his potential race strategy in his pre-race interview. “The wind always plays a role here, and there’s a chance of rain later on, which would only make the race even harder.”
And for Evenepoel, the harder the race the better the chance of victory. “We’ll do everything we can to wear down the really explosive guys as much as possible and see what’s possible from there. The Mur de Huy doesn’t suit me quite as well as those lighter, punchy riders - like Thibau Nys, for example - so we’ll have to push the pace early," he explains. "But I don’t think we’ll be the only ones with that strategy. I’m sure UAE will try something similar.”
“If it does come down to a sprint, I’ll try to make the best of it," concludes the Belgian's preview. "Positioning will be crucial, and then I just have to believe in my own chances.”
